Why These Are the Top Flooring Installers Contractors in Francis

** The flooring installers market serving Francis, Oklahoma, is characterized by regional contractors based in larger nearby hubs like Ada (approx. 20 miles away) and Sulphur (approx. 15 miles away). Due to Francis's small size, there are no dedicated flooring contractors operating solely within the city limits. The competition level is moderate, with a handful of established, reputable providers dominating the service area. These companies have built long-standing reputations (often 10+ years) and maintain strong review profiles on local platforms. The average quality of service is considered good to high, with these top providers demonstrating expertise in modern materials like LVP and traditional hardwood alike. Typical pricing is competitive for rural Oklahoma, but projects may include a travel fee. Ballpark installation costs range from $3-$7 per square foot for laminate/LVP, $5-$10+ per square foot for tile, and $8-$15+ per square foot for hardwood, with final prices heavily dependent on the project scope, material choice, and any required subfloor repair.

Frequently Asked Questions About Flooring Installers in Francis

Get answers to common questions about flooring installers services in Francis, Oklahoma.

1What is the average cost to install new flooring in a Francis home, and what factors influence the price?

In the Francis area, average installation costs range from $3-$8 per square foot for materials and labor, but can go higher for premium products. Key factors include the flooring type (Oklahoma-hardy options like luxury vinyl plank are popular), the condition of your subfloor, and the home's layout. Local material availability and fuel surcharges for contractor travel in our rural area can also affect the final quote.

2How does Oklahoma's climate affect my choice of flooring and the installation process?

Our region experiences significant humidity shifts and temperature extremes, which can cause wood to expand/contract and adhesive to cure improperly. We recommend acclimating flooring materials inside your home for 48-72 hours before installation, regardless of season. For durability, moisture-resistant options like tile or engineered vinyl are excellent for handling our variable conditions from humid summers to dry winters.

3Are there specific times of year that are better or worse for flooring installation in Francis?

Late spring and early fall are often ideal, offering moderate temperatures and humidity for proper adhesive setting and material acclimation. Winter installations are possible but require careful climate control in your home to prevent issues with cold subfloors and materials delivered from a freezing truck. Summer installations need to account for high humidity, which may require running dehumidifiers.

4What should I look for when choosing a local flooring installer in the Francis area?

Prioritize licensed and insured contractors familiar with older home foundations common in our region. Ask for local references and examples of work in Pontotoc or surrounding counties. A reputable installer will provide a detailed, written estimate that includes preparation work like subfloor leveling, which is often needed in Oklahoma homes due to soil movement.

5Do I need a permit for flooring installation in Francis, and are there any common local issues I should prepare for?

Generally, simple flooring replacement does not require a permit in Francis, but structural changes to the subfloor might. A more common local concern is dealing with uneven concrete slabs or original wood subfloors in older homes, which often need leveling. It's also wise to check for asbestos in adhesive or tiles if your Francis home was built before the 1980s, requiring specialized abatement.
